在m至n的自然数中,输出所有各位数之和等于7的整数个数K
来源:学生作业帮助网 编辑:作业帮 时间:2024/11/05 19:05:07
if(flag==1&&n!=1)这里错了你少了=
m^2-n^2=45(m+n)(m-n)=45m,n为整数所以m+n和m-n为整数45=1*45=3*15=5*9=(-1)*(-45)=(-3)*(-15)=(-5)*(-9)所以可以列出12个二元
#include#includeintfib(intn){\x09inti,*A;\x09A=(int*)malloc(sizeof(int)*n);//动态申请内存\x09A[0]=1;A[1]=1
#includeintf(intx){\x05intn=0,i,k=1,flag=1;\x05while(flag)\x05{\x05\x05flag=0;\x05\x05for(i=k;x%i;i+
while(m
应该是1291,分位数算就是.
{----------根据题目补充已修改----------}programEugene;varm,n,ans:int64;beginreadln(m,n);ans:=0;iftrunc(m)mod2
没想到什么好方法,只能结合简单估计枚举验算.设N为k位数,即10^(k-1)≤NN^7至多有7k位,f(N^7)≤9·7k=63k.可以证明k≥4时,63k又N至多为3位数,f(N^7)≤189,故只
floatfun(intn){floatsum=0;inti;for(i=1;i
不建议你用这种for(i=2;i=3){for(i=2;i
counter=0;fori=1:nforj=(i+1):(n-1)if(sum(i:j)==n){counter=counter+1;disp(i:j);}endend好运!再问:我对这软件一点不了
格式修饰符最小域宽限定符精度限定符对齐输出*和#修饰符格式修饰符 许多格式限定符都有修饰符用于稍微改变它们的含义.例如,可以规定最小域宽、小数位数及向左对齐.格式修饰符放在百分号与格式代码之间.最小
在1×2×3×...×2000=7的N次方×M的等式中2000/7=285.5,共有285个数是7的倍数2000/49=40.40,共有40个数是49的倍数2000/343=5.285,共有5个数是3
回车是\n不是/ns=i,之后你却用i/10处理,你让for循环怎么看i,你让s情何以堪j用完也不清零,j越来越大.再问:明白!
sum=0fori=1to100if(imod3)thensum=sum+inextiprintsum
在界面上放一个按钮就行了,然后将下面的代码复制到代码窗口.PrivateSubCommand1_Click()Me.Clsi=0Forj=1To500IfjMod17=0ThenIfi=5Theni=
解题思路:考查了命题真假的判断与应用,考查了同余的性质解题过程:最终答案:D
voidfun(){intn,i,sum=0;printf("n=");scanf("%d",&n);for(i=n;i>=0;i--){if(i%5==0&&i%9==0)sum+=i;}print
//#include"stdafx.h"//vc++6.0加上这一行.#include"stdio.h"#include"string.h"#include"stdlib.h"boolprime(in
这道题应该这个思路,有10个连续的非零连续自然数的约数,所以这个数分解质因数后肯定至少含有5个2,至少含有3个3,至少含有2个5,至少含有1个7.那么我们先把它表示成2^5*3^3*5^2*7*n,后